Oppo Reno 13 Pro Price Slashed, Competes with Flagship Models

The price of the Oppo Reno 13 Pro has dramatically decreased, making it a compelling option in the competitive upper mid-price range of smartphones. Currently priced at just €527 on Amazon, the device offers a significant discount compared to its original retail price of €779 at Currys. This reduction positions the Reno 13 Pro as a strong contender against flagship models such as the iPhone 16e (€859 for 256GB), Honor 400 Pro (€699 for 512GB), Redmagic 10 Air (€649), and Samsung S25 (€969 for 256GB).
Oppo Reno 13 Pro: Design and Performance
The Oppo Reno 13 Pro, which has been absent from the Oppo Ireland website, is available on the Oppo UK site. It boasts a sleek design with a weight of only 195 grams, making it comfortable for everyday use. Its impressive 6.83-inch display features a Full HD+ resolution with a peak brightness of 1,200 nits and a refresh rate of 120Hz, providing vibrant visuals and smooth scrolling.
Powered by the MediaTek Dimensity 8350, a mid-range chip, the Reno 13 Pro handles demanding applications and games effortlessly. With 512GB of storage and 12GB of LPDDR5X RAM, it ensures a fluid user experience. The device runs on ColorOS 15, a well-optimized version of Android that includes the latest AI tools and promises six years of software and security updates.
Battery performance is another highlight, with a robust 5,800mAh battery that can last close to two days for most users. The phone supports rapid 80W wired charging, allowing it to recharge fully in about an hour.
Camera System and Additional Features
The Oppo Reno 13 Pro features a versatile camera system that includes three rear cameras: a 50MP main camera, a 50MP telephoto lens, and an 8MP ultra-wide lens. The front-facing camera, also 50MP, captures high-quality selfies. All lenses allow for video recording at 4K resolution and up to 60 frames per second, offering exceptional performance for photography enthusiasts.
Additional features include support for 5G, WiFi 6e, Bluetooth 5.4, and NFC, as well as an infrared blaster that can be used to control compatible devices. The phone also supports high-quality audio codecs such as aptX-HD and LDAC, enhancing the audio experience.
While the Reno 13 Pro excels in many areas, it does have some limitations. The USB-C port is only gen 2.0, which restricts data transfer speeds. However, the device offers convenient unlocking options, including facial recognition and a reliable fingerprint sensor.
The Oppo Reno 13 Pro stands out with its combination of a stylish design, excellent battery life, and a capable camera system. With Amazon’s current pricing, it presents a strong value proposition for users seeking a smartphone that rivals flagship devices without breaking the bank.
At €527, the Oppo Reno 13 Pro is positioned as a budget-friendly alternative that does not compromise on quality or performance, making it an attractive option for consumers looking to upgrade their smartphone in 2025.
